/*
 * NV20
 * -----
 * There are 3 families :
 * NV20 is 0x10de:0x020*
 * NV25/28 is 0x10de:0x025* / 0x10de:0x028*
 * NV2A is 0x10de:0x02A0
 *
 * NV30
 * -----
 * There are 3 families :
 * NV30/31 is 0x10de:0x030* / 0x10de:0x031*
 * NV34 is 0x10de:0x032*
 * NV35/36 is 0x10de:0x033* / 0x10de:0x034*
 *
 * Not seen in the wild, no dumps (probably NV35) :
 * NV37 is 0x10de:0x00fc, 0x10de:0x00fd
 * NV38 is 0x10de:0x0333, 0x10de:0x00fe
 *
 */

#define NV20_GRCTX_SIZE (3580*4)
#define NV25_GRCTX_SIZE (3529*4)
#define NV2A_GRCTX_SIZE (3500*4)

#define NV30_31_GRCTX_SIZE (24392)
#define NV34_GRCTX_SIZE    (18140)
#define NV35_36_GRCTX_SIZE (22396)
